Output d268284b7dfce8f4d1522b6b5cef21132ffe65ab8735ea8b8ea66f265a40988a: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646683223f7ae6356bb18e1bf65efaad9673d55a OP_EQUAL
address
3AqtJQHEEHp83CQUTDpepxPAua5VikEfMC
transaction
d268284b7dfce8f4d1522b6b5cef21132ffe65ab8735ea8b8ea66f265a40988a
spent
true